Have you been feeling like your witness isn’t very effective? Have you been inconsistent with your time of Bible study or prayer? Serving God always and everywhere is not easy, but Dr. Michael Youssef says that praise can help. Dr. Youssef describes praise as “the fuel that makes us effective.” Praise creates a stronger desire for God and enables us to serve Him and to trust Him more completely. Praise improves your prayer life, and it helps you to overcome Satan and the challenges you’re facing. Learn how praise can make all the difference in your life through this six-part teaching series Empowered by Praise.
